Good question. I'd say that it is, but only IF you went in with an open mind. Like, if you went in being all James Rolfe-ish about it (see video below) and come out saying that, based purely on merit, that it's a shit movie.. then nah. I'd say your biases meant you wouldn't enjoy it regardless of the quality. However, if you went in like "yaaay new Ghostbusters movie and I am happy/neutral on the subject of recasting and rebooting" but afterwards was like "nah, bit shit really" then fair cop I'd say.

The real source of friction seems to be the style of the comedy - particularly based on the trailer. It has the same director and a lot of the same cast as Bridesmaids. A movie which I expected to hate but ADORED. It's more of a modern, almost slapstick comedy than the dry wit of the original and people seem to be pissed off that it's not the same. That and the "Ghostbusters is a bit sacred to me" type of mindset seem to be the two main bones of contention that aren't fucking chimps screaming about reverse sexism.

Slight spoilers ahead:

Minor gripes. I felt there wasn't enough establishment of them as Ghostbusters, you saw them catching like two ghosts and then they were in the final battle. In the first film there was a montage of them bustin', and their TV adverts and magazine covers and stuff. I just thought there should have been a little bit more of an arc for them. The final battle was over far too quickly, they just turned up and killed the big baddie and that was it. It barely even put up a fight. And Bill Murray's cameo was terrible, it was a throwaway role that could have been done by anyone, it was a waste of Bill Murray.  He didn't seem like he wanted to even be there. Also the siren.

By and large I thought it was really good though.
